实现这个功能,可以使用 WPF 的 Canvas 控件和 Path 控件。

首先,需要准备好数据,即一组 Y、X 的值,可以将它们存储在一个二维数组中。

然后,在 Canvas 控件上创建一个 Path 控件,设置其 Stroke 属性为所需的曲线颜色,StrokeThickness 属性为曲线宽度。

接下来,使用 PathGeometry 类创建一个 PathFigure 对象,并将其 StartPoint 属性设置为第一个数据点的坐标。然后,使用 LineSegment 类创建一系列线段,将它们添加到 PathFigure 对象的 Segments 集合中,以形成曲线。最后,将 PathFigure 对象添加到 PathGeometry 对象的 Figures 集合中。

最后,将 PathGeometry 对象设置为 Path 控件的 Data 属性,即可在 Canvas 上显示出走势曲线图。

WPF 使用 Canvas 和 Path 绘制走势曲线图

原文地址: https://www.cveoy.top/t/topic/jM5k 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录